[arch-commits] Commit in php-composer/trunk (PKGBUILD php php.ini)
Pierre Schmitz
pierre at archlinux.org
Tue Dec 29 07:37:42 UTC 2015
Date: Tuesday, December 29, 2015 @ 08:37:42
Author: pierre
Revision: 257359
upgpkg: php-composer 1.0.0.alpha11-3
Modified:
php-composer/trunk/PKGBUILD
Deleted:
php-composer/trunk/php
php-composer/trunk/php.ini
----------+
PKGBUILD | 17 +++++++----------
php | 3 ---
php.ini | 10 ----------
3 files changed, 7 insertions(+), 23 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2015-12-29 07:35:09 UTC (rev 257358)
+++ PKGBUILD 2015-12-29 07:37:42 UTC (rev 257359)
@@ -4,7 +4,7 @@
pkgname=php-composer
_tag=1.0.0-alpha11
pkgver=${_tag/-/.}
-pkgrel=1
+pkgrel=3
pkgdesc="Dependency Manager for PHP"
arch=('any')
license=('MIT')
@@ -12,19 +12,13 @@
depends=('php')
makedepends=('git')
source=("${pkgname}::git+https://github.com/composer/composer.git#tag=${_tag}"
- "composer-${pkgver}.phar::https://getcomposer.org/download/${_tag}/composer.phar"
- 'php' 'php.ini')
+ "composer-${pkgver}.phar::https://getcomposer.org/download/${_tag}/composer.phar")
md5sums=('SKIP'
- '488ca7972e447e0e1b2988f66d8e01e6'
- '407acec5e2be64bc18c95fadb2ad86d4'
- '5cc154807e3a7a990657c1c4bcc80149')
+ '488ca7972e447e0e1b2988f66d8e01e6')
prepare() {
cd ${srcdir}/${pkgname}
- # Use a php wrapper which is configured with the required modules
- export PATH=${srcdir}:$PATH
-
php ${srcdir}/composer-${pkgver}.phar -n install --no-dev
}
@@ -31,12 +25,15 @@
build() {
cd ${srcdir}/${pkgname}
- bin/compile
+ php -d phar.readonly=Off bin/compile
}
check() {
cd ${srcdir}/${pkgname}
+ # check if the upstream build and ours differ
+ diff -q ${srcdir}/composer-${pkgver}.phar composer.phar
+
# Install the dev dependencies to run the unit tests
bin/composer -n install
vendor/bin/phpunit
Deleted: php
===================================================================
--- php 2015-12-29 07:35:09 UTC (rev 257358)
+++ php 2015-12-29 07:37:42 UTC (rev 257359)
@@ -1,3 +0,0 @@
-#!/bin/bash
-
-/usr/bin/php -nc $(dirname $0)/php.ini ${@}
Deleted: php.ini
===================================================================
--- php.ini 2015-12-29 07:35:09 UTC (rev 257358)
+++ php.ini 2015-12-29 07:37:42 UTC (rev 257359)
@@ -1,10 +0,0 @@
-[PHP]
-memory_limit=-1
-extension=openssl.so
-extension=phar.so
-extension=zip.so
-extension=curl.so
-[Date]
-date.timezone=UTC
-[Phar]
-phar.readonly=Off
More information about the arch-commits
mailing list